Abstract

The word “herpes” (to creep) has been used in medicine since ancient times to describe a variety of skin conditions until the ninteenth century. The material excreted from the lesions was thaught to be bile mixed with other humors (Wildy, 1973). Since the fourth decade of this century, rapid developments in the understanding of viral diseases have considerably changed the concept of herpesvirus infections.
